PURPOSE: To manufacture a chemical diode usable as a component of a viochip by a method wherein an easily reducing material as an electron receptor and a reversibly oxidizing and reducing material as a mediator are laid between an opposite pole as a positive electrode and a working pole as a negative electrode.
CONSTITUTION: An easily reducing material 2a as an electron receptor and a reversibly oxidizing and reducing material 3a as a mediator are laid between an opposite pole 1 as a positive electrode and a working pole 4 as a negative electrode. Or an easily oxidizing material 2b as an electron donor and a reversibly oxidizing and reducing material 3b as a mediator are laid between an opposite pole 1 as a negative electrode and a working pole 4 as a positive electrode. For example, the opposite pole 1 and the working pole 4 are oppositely arranged and the easily reducing material 2a as the electron receptor, e.g., ferritin fixed to a porous medium is provided between the opposite pole 1 and the working pole 4 while the reversibly oxidizing and reducing material 3a, e.g., ascorbic acid is spread to said porous medium.
